Output ecc1527c8a06a4b657b5652b000f2dacd2ce32844230b9af91e9bda0e517c433:24

value
9582901
script pubkey
OP_0 OP_PUSHBYTES_20 377a589efb8c64c7ae56b86d622d86420fd00974
address
bc1qxaa938hm33jv0tjkhpkkytvxgg8aqzt5dfgs64
transaction
ecc1527c8a06a4b657b5652b000f2dacd2ce32844230b9af91e9bda0e517c433